Regional Enterprise Plan

This new Regional Enterprise Plan to 2024 for Dublin is future focused and centred around the following priorities:  an ambition to strengthening resilience amongst Dublin’s SMEs and Start-Ups; promoting attractive and adaptive place-making; encouraging inclusion for all citizens of Dublin seeking to engage in economic activity; positioning Dublin based businesses as leaders in the low carbon transition; and taking steps to ensure the availability of skills and talent to meet future economic needs.
